Description

A challenging and scenic Moab trail that blends classic slickrock driving with big, intimidating obstacles and wide-open desert views. The route winds through fins, sandy sections, and technical rock features, with optional lines that can significantly increase the difficulty. Signature obstacles like High Dive and White Knuckle Hill test both driver confidence and vehicle capability, with steep climbs and descents that demand careful line choice. While there are moments to catch your breath and enjoy the scenery, this trail leans technical overall and is best suited for well-equipped rigs and experienced drivers looking for a full-value Moab run. This is the published Red Rock 4-Wheelers route.
